Levon Helm of the rock group The Band is from Marvell, Arkansas.
Bernie Taupin, who wrote the lyrics for "Levon," was inspired by The Band's co-founder, drummer, and singer Levon Helm to name the title character after him. The Band was apparently Elton John's and Bernie Taupin's favorite group in those days.
Levon Helm's birth name is Mark Lavon Helm.
Levon Helm is 5' 8".
Levon Helm was born on May 26, 1940.
Levon Helm was the drummer and a vocalist in the group The Band.
Levon Helm was a drummer and vocalist for The Band. The Band was famous for songs such as "The Weight," "The Night They Drove Old Dixie Down," and "Up on Cripple Creek."
